Circular window replacement services involve removing an existing round or arched window and installing a new one that fits the same opening. This process typically includes measuring the space, selecting a suitable style and material, and ensuring a proper fit to maintain the window’s structural integrity. The service may also involve sealing and finishing work to enhance insulation and appearance, helping to restore or improve the aesthetic appeal of a property while ensuring the window functions correctly.
These services address common problems such as drafts, leaks, or damage that can compromise a window’s performance over time. A cracked or broken circular window can lead to energy loss and increased utility bills, while outdated or poorly fitted windows may diminish a building’s overall look and curb appeal. Replacing a damaged or inefficient circular window can also improve security and reduce the likelihood of further damage caused by weather elements or accidental impact.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for circular window replacement typ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the size and type of glass used. Custom or specialty glass options may increase the price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a circular window generally fall between $200 and $800 per window. Factors influencing price include window size, complexity of installation, and local labor rates. Contractors can offer precise quotes after assessing the project.
Additional Fees - Additional costs such as removal of old windows, framing adjustments, or permits can add $50 to $300 to the total project. These fees vary based on the scope of work and local regulations. Pros can clarify potential extra charges during consultations.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the complete cost for circular window replacement typically ranges from $400 to $1,700 per window. Exact prices depend on material choices, installation complexity, and regional pricing differences. Contact local service providers for tailored est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are circular window replacement services? Circular window replacement services involve removing and installing new circular or round windows to enhance the appearance and functionality of a building's interior or exterior.
How do I know if my circular window needs to be replaced? Signs that may indicate the need for replacement include difficulty opening or closing, visible damage, drafts, or water leaks around the window frame.
What materials are used for circular window replacements? Common materials for circular window replacements include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ass, each offering different aesthetic and durability benefits.
How long does a circular window replacement typically take? The duration of a circular window replacement can vary depending on the complexity, but generally, it takes a few hours to a full day to complete.
